Some interesting facts about the integration of AI into the film industry: James Cameron is on the board of Stability. Darren Aronofsky partnered with DeepMind. Ron Howard called AI "revolutionary" for filmmaking. Robert Zemeckis has used AI extensively. Zack Snyder endorses AI. Scorcese used AI to de-age Deniro in the Irishman. Taika Waititi used an AI baby in Love and Thunder. Denis Villeneuve used AI to automatically tint the eyes blue in Dune Part Two. George Miller used AI in Mad Mad: Fury Road. AI is already integrated into many modern film pipelines in some capacity - while others may focus on "in the lens" production. Both seem like valid pathways for their given audiences. But for the larger scale commercial side of production, some level of AI integration seems inevitable. The question now is "how do we best integrate AI into the creative process?" What kind of things do we as creatives find helpful, and what are the things that are detracting from our human expression or our ability to connect emotionally to the material? We don't yet know the answers to these questions, but IMHO, mindful stewardship of the medium involves mindfully asking, experimenting and attempting to answer these questions earnestly.

⚡ Fast, Secure Offload for URSA Cine Immersive ⚡ Recently had the privilege to deep dive into the Blackmagic Design's URSA Cine Immersive workflow with Leon Barnard and was blown away. My first question... "How much data is that spitting out? Answer: It can generate 11.6 TB per hour. This means offload speed becomes mission-critical. Every minute does matter! Pairing the Blackmagic Media Dock with iodyne Pro Data (96 TB or 192 TB) delivers a clean, modern workflow: fast multi-10G ingest, encrypted RAID-6 protection, and sustained multi-GB/s write speeds. That means a full 8 TB media module offloaded in roughly 1 hour, all to a single secure container instead of juggling loose drives. For productions dealing with massive data volumes, this setup shows how performance, capacity, and protection can coexist on set without slowing things down. It’s time for Freeway’s next video 📺, about paying US Guild Residuals to members of SAG-AFTRA, DGA and WGA, using a Collection Account.👇 🤔 What are Guild Residuals and how does a Collection Account with Freeway make sure that Independent Film Producers pay Residuals correctly? ➡️ Residuals are additional compensation payments which may become due and payable by the Production Company to Actors, Directors and Screenwriters, under the Basic Agreements. ➡️ Residuals may become due when a Film is exhibited, distributed, or otherwise exploited, domestically and/or internationally, beyond its initial theatrical exhibition. ➡️ This can include pay and free TV, home video and DVD, streaming and new media. 🧐 How are Guild Residuals calculated and paid? ➡️ Guild Residuals are payable on worldwide revenues. ➡️ The Production Company will set up a Collection Account with Freeway as neutral third party Collection Account Manager (CAM) to manage the receipt, administration and allocation of revenues. ➡️ The Production Company and the Sales Agent will instruct the local buyers or Distributors, to pay revenues due under the Film’s Distribution Agreements, into the Collection Account. ➡️ Freeway sets aside, off the top and from every dollar received in the Collection Account, a fixed percentage which goes to a Residuals-Set-Aside. ➡️ A Payroll House, appointed by the Production Company, will calculate the exact amounts of Residuals payable, based on information like worldwide revenue reports and the Film’s media allocation. ➡️ Freeway is periodically notified by the Payroll House of the exact amounts of Residuals payable. Each time the CAM receives an invoice from the Payroll House, Freeway pays the total amount of Residuals payable from the Residuals-Set-Aside to the Payroll House. ▶️ The Payroll House will then cut the checks and pay each Guild Member individually. 👉 Do you have US Guild Members in your Film, and do you want to know more about paying Residuals through a Collection Account with Freeway? ✅ Contact Freeway Entertainment Group or visit the website: https://lnkd.in/gu_dXThz.
